How to fill out journal entry form

Illustration

How to fill out Journal Entry Form

01
Obtain the Journal Entry Form from your accounting department or download it from the company's internal portal.
02
Fill in the date of the transaction in the designated field at the top of the form.
03
Provide a clear description of the transaction in the description section.
04
Enter the debits and credits in the appropriate columns, ensuring the totals are equal.
05
Include the account numbers related to the debits and credits in the respective columns.
06
Review the completed form for accuracy and completeness.
07
Obtain the necessary signatures for approval, if required.
08
Submit the form to the accounting department for processing.

The format of Journal Entry is prepared with 5 columns starting from Date, Particulars, Ledger Folio (LF), Debit Amount & Credit Amount. The word 'journal' has been derived from the French word 'JOUR' meaning daily records. Journal Book is maintained to have prime records for small firms.
Each journal entry contains the data significant to a single business transaction, including the date, the amount to be credited and debited, a brief description of the transaction and the accounts affected. Depending on the company, it may list affected subsidiaries, tax details and other information.
A journal entry has the following components: The date of the transaction. The account name and number for each account impacted. The credit and debit amount. A reference number that serves as a unique identifier for the transaction. A description of the transaction.

A Journal Entry Form is a record used in accounting to document financial transactions that do not occur through standard invoicing or billing processes. It allows accountants to manually enter adjustments, corrections, or other entries directly to the general ledger.
Typically, accountants, finance professionals, or individuals responsible for financial record-keeping within an organization are required to file a Journal Entry Form. This may include accountants in businesses, non-profits, and governmental entities.
To fill out a Journal Entry Form, one must include the date of the transaction, accounts affected, the debits and credits amounts for each account, a description of the transaction, and any relevant reference numbers or supporting documentation.
The purpose of the Journal Entry Form is to accurately record financial transactions ensuring proper documentation is maintained for accounting purposes such as audits, financial reporting, and maintaining accurate general ledger entries.
The information that must be reported on a Journal Entry Form includes the date of the entry, account names, debit amounts, credit amounts, a description of the transaction, and any related documentation or reference numbers necessary for the entry.
